Background
He Yang is a third year PhD student in the Department of Mathematical Sciences at Rensselaer Polytechnic Institute. He joined RPI as a Research Assistant under the supervision of Prof. Fengyan Li from September, 2010. During September to December 2011, He was a visiting researcher in the Institute for Computational and Experimental Research in Mathematics (ICERM) at Brown University.
Research Interests
Numerical
Analysis and Scientific Computing, including but not limited
to
- Stability and error analysis of discontinuous Galerkin methods for partial differential equations
- High order numerical methods for problems in Plasma Physics and Magnetohydrodynamics
